Well I have had this female R. auriculatus (gargoyle) for 2 years now 3 in July and she has laid some unfertilized eggs in the past. However for some reason she is on a marathon and been laying them every month for the last four months I found the latest one tonight. Is this odd behavior? I have never had ciliatus' do this nor have I had any other gecko do this. usually its one or 2 lays (when there is no male present) and it stops. She is on MRP and still seems to be healthy not acting strange fecal matter is normal eating fine. Has anyone seen similar behavior? It may help to mention too she has never been introduced to a male and lives alone (like they prefer it... little hermits he he he). Just thought it might make an interesting topic.
